How much do part time entry level real estate j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for part time entry level real estate in the United States is $48,610.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$38,000.00 and $54,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Part Time Entry Level Real Estate vs Part Time Entry Level Real Estate Agent?

AspectPart Time Entry Level Real EstatePart Time Entry Level Real Estate Agent
CredentialsNone required; may need real estate license depending on stateReal estate license required
Work EnvironmentSupport roles, administrative tasks, assisting agentsClient-facing, property showings, negotiations
Employer & Industry UsageBrokerages, real estate firms, property managementReal estate brokerages, agencies
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ding entry-level support roles in real estateEntry-level real estate sales roles

Part Time Entry Level Real Estate typically involves support and administrative tasks within real estate firms, often not requiring a license. In contrast, Part Time Entry Level Real Estate Agent involves direct client interaction and property sales, requiring a valid real estate license. Both roles serve different functions but are essential in the real estate industry for those starting their careers.
